    farley wizard

    Hi All,
    I am interested in this machine, FARLEY PLASMA / PROFILE CUTTING MACHINE, MANUFACTURE DATE 1987, 1500MM X 6000MM CUTTING TABLE, HYPERTHERM MAX 100D, HEIGHT SENSING AND GAS MIXING CONSOLE, that is up for auction at the moment, I am interested in feedback from anyone that may have used this type of machine so I can have an idea of how it performs, we would be cutting steel plate up to 12mm thick mainly.

    regards,

    Kevin

    The Farley machines are very well built machines.....from Australia. I would dare say that they are equivalent to high end Esab and MG and Koike Industrial grade machines for plasma and oxyfuel applications. Farley service is handled out of their Illinois offices....and John Johnson....one of the principals at Farley Illinois is a great guy.

    these machines are big, heavy....and will last as long as a Bridgeport Milling machine if taken care of......they are by no means a "hobbyist" class cutting machine!

    You may want to upgrade the plasma...the 100D is an oler technology system...

    Jim Colt
